How Traffic Noise and Game Design Influence Our Choices

1. Introduction: Understanding How External Stimuli Influence Human Decision-Making

Our decisions are rarely made in isolation. Instead, they are subtly shaped by various external factors present in our environment. These factors include auditory, visual, and even olfactory stimuli that influence our perceptions and subconscious preferences. Recognizing these influences helps us understand why we sometimes make choices that seem contrary to our best interests.

In modern settings, traffic noise and game design stand out as powerful, yet often overlooked, influences. Traffic noise, omnipresent in urban life, can alter stress levels and risk perception. Meanwhile, the design of digital games—through visuals, sounds, and reward systems—can nudge players toward specific behaviors. This article explores how these external stimuli operate and their implications for human decision-making.

2. The Psychology of Environmental Cues: How Surroundings Shape Behavior

The environment around us constantly provides sensory information that influences our subconscious mind. Sensory perception involves complex neural processes that interpret stimuli such as sounds, sights, and smells, often affecting our behavior without our explicit awareness. This subconscious influence is a fundamental aspect of human psychology, guiding decisions in ways we may not immediately recognize.

Auditory stimuli, in particular, play a significant role. Sounds can evoke emotional responses, alter mood, and even change our risk perception. For example, a calm melody in a shopping mall can encourage leisurely browsing, while loud, aggressive music in a store might push customers to move faster. Similarly, in entertainment environments, sound design is meticulously crafted to elicit specific reactions.

An illustrative example is how background noise in urban settings influences pedestrian and driver behavior. Noises that are loud and unpredictable tend to heighten stress and may cause impulsive decisions. Recognition of these effects is crucial for urban planners and designers aiming to create environments that promote safety and well-being.

3. Traffic Noise as a Non-Obvious Behavioral Modifier

Traffic noise, often viewed as a mere nuisance, has profound psychological effects. Studies have demonstrated that chronic exposure to urban soundscapes increases stress hormones like cortisol, which can impair decision-making and escalate impulsive behaviors. For instance, drivers exposed to loud traffic tend to take more risks, such as speeding or aggressive maneuvers, believing they need to compensate for the chaos around them.

Similarly, pedestrians crossing streets amid heavy traffic may make hasty decisions, underestimating the time they have or the risk involved. Research published in environmental psychology journals indicates that noisy environments decrease patience and heighten the likelihood of risk-taking, showcasing how a seemingly external factor can shape vital choices.

For example, a case study in a busy metropolitan area revealed that during periods of heightened traffic noise, more pedestrians jaywalked, and drivers exhibited less cautious behavior. This demonstrates how urban soundscapes influence decision patterns subtly yet significantly.

4. The Mechanics of Game Design and Choice Architecture

Game design employs principles of choice architecture—how choices are presented—to influence player behavior. Through visual cues, sound effects, rewards, and even time constraints, designers guide players toward specific actions, often aligning with the game’s goals or monetization strategies.

Sound plays a crucial role: positive auditory feedback reinforces desired behaviors, while subtle cues can nudge players to explore certain options. Visual elements like color schemes and interface layouts also prime players to make particular choices. Moreover, reward systems—such as points, badges, or in-game currency—are structured to motivate continued engagement and influence decision pathways.

Digital environments often mimic real-world stimuli to enhance immersion and sway preferences. For example, bright, cheerful visuals with rewarding sounds encourage prolonged play, while dark, ominous tones may induce caution or hesitation. This intentional design aligns with research showing how environmental cues shape choices across contexts.

6. Psychological and Biological Foundations: Why We Are Susceptible to External Cues

The susceptibility to environmental cues has deep evolutionary roots. In animals, imprinting—a process where early exposure to certain stimuli shapes future behavior—serves as a foundational example. For instance, chicks exposed to specific sounds or visual cues during their first 48 hours develop strong preferences, a process that parallels humans’ responsiveness to early environmental influences.

On a neurobiological level, auditory and visual stimuli activate pathways in the brain’s limbic system, affecting emotions and decision-making. The amygdala, for example, responds strongly to threatening or rewarding stimuli, influencing impulses and preferences. Early imprinting, whether in animals or humans, demonstrates the powerful impact of stimuli during critical periods, shaping lifelong decision tendencies.

Understanding these biological responses is vital for appreciating how external cues—like traffic noise or game sounds—can sway choices, often beyond our conscious awareness.

8. Ethical Considerations and the Role of Awareness

While leveraging environmental and design cues can enhance user experience, it also raises ethical concerns. Manipulative practices—such as using subtle sounds or visual cues to induce gambling behaviors—can exploit psychological vulnerabilities. Transparency and user awareness are critical in mitigating potential harm.

Consumers can develop strategies to recognize external influences, such as questioning their emotional responses or evaluating the intent behind design choices. Education about how stimuli work empowers individuals to make more conscious decisions.

Designers and urban planners bear responsibility for creating environments that prioritize well-being over profit or control. Incorporating ethical guidelines and promoting informed consent can help ensure that external stimuli serve constructive purposes.
